The Significance of Eligibility Verification in Medical Billing

Eligibility verification process in medical billing is the foundation of a successful revenue cycle. It determines whether a patient is covered by their insurance and whether the provider is eligible to receive payment for the services delivered. This process includes verifying the policy number, coverage start and end dates, deductibles, eligibility in medical billing and whether pre-authorizations are required.

Without a reliable eligibility check, healthcare providers risk delivering services that may not be reimbursed. For example, if a patient is ineligible at the time of service, the claim could be denied, causing delays and financial loss for the provider.

Aligning Eligibility Verification with Place of Service Codes

Once a patient's eligibility is verified, the billing team must ensure that the place of service (POS) code used on the claim matches where the care was delivered. Place of service 11 in medical billing represents the physician’s office. When submitting claims with this code, it must be clear that the provider delivered the care in a clinical office setting rather than a hospital or facility.

Incorrectly matching a patient’s eligibility with the wrong POS code may result in claim rejections, overpayments, or audits. Therefore, accurate eligibility data must be synchronized with coding practices to avoid compliance issues.

Benefits of Coordinating Eligibility and POS 11

Coordinating the eligibility verification process with the use of POS 11 ensures accurate claim submission. It helps determine not just whether the patient has insurance, but also whether that insurance recognizes services rendered in a physician’s office.

For instance, some plans may reimburse services differently based on the service location. If POS 11 is misused or unsupported by the patient's policy, providers may receive lower payments or no reimbursement at all.
